What do mechanical waves travel faster in?

Mechanical waves generally travel faster in solids compared to liquids and gases. This is because the particles in solids are closely packed, allowing for faster transmission of the wave energy through the medium.

Where does sound travel faster in?

Sound travels faster in solids than in liquids, and faster in liquids than in gases. This is because solids are more densely packed, allowing sound waves to propagate more effectively through their structure.
